Transaction 70d667a63dd01247d32f6a9f49481e636dd3e98b450c2a9bf50b7bcc49ce910b

1 Input
2 Outputs
  • 70d667a63dd01247d32f6a9f49481e636dd3e98b450c2a9bf50b7bcc49ce910b:0
  • value  310192029
    address  15w8qZBHVcJnatc9gBtRV88id9um8a6YZH
  • 70d667a63dd01247d32f6a9f49481e636dd3e98b450c2a9bf50b7bcc49ce910b:1
  • value  270000
    address  3NytszH1V2UeeGDJ3EqjnZBfiZHgeVDR7t